Understanding Personal Injury Law
Arizona's personal injury law is crafted to shield individuals who suffer harm because of someone else’s carelessness or deliberate conduct.
At its core, this area of law focuses on holding the responsible party accountable for their misconduct, so that victims obtain the rightful compensation.
In Phoenix, AZ, injury claims often center on claims such as car accidents, slip and fall incidents, or other mishaps where liability is evident.
By grasping fundamental legal principles like negligence, duty of care, and comparative fault, clients can understand how their case fits within this comprehensive legal system.
In addition to the conventional definitions, state-specific elements are crucial for shaping personal injury claims.
For example, Arizona adopts a comparative fault system, which means the compensation may be adjusted based on the degree of fault attributed.
Knowledgeable personal injury lawyers help simplify these concepts, translating complicated legal terms into clear, actionable steps for their clients.

How a Lawyer Supports You Throughout the Process
A personal injury attorney provides complete assistance, supporting clients from claim initiation to settlement. This guidance begins with an initial consultation where the lawyer listens to your account and evaluates the strength of your case. From there, the process includes several critical steps:
- Investigation: Gathering evidence, interviewing witnesses, and collaborating with specialists to rebuild the incident.
- Documentation: Collecting medical records, law enforcement reports, and other vital documents that substantiate your claim.
- Negotiation: Communicating with insurers to ensure a fair settlement covering present and forthcoming requirements.
- Litigation: Should equitable terms not be achieved, the case may proceed to trial necessitating expert litigation skills.
Working with a committed lawyer ensures that every facet of your case is managed professionally. With personalized support, transparent communication, and a methodical approach, clients in Phoenix and surrounding areas are better equipped by the legal complexities they face.

Understanding Fees and Payment Structures
Grasping the fee structure is just as important as evaluating credentials. Numerous personal injury attorneys work on a contingency fee basis, meaning they only get paid if you win your case. It minimizes the financial risk for clients and synchronizes the lawyer’s incentives with your case result.
Transparent fee discussions and zero initial fees also demonstrates an attorney's dedication to openness. This fee arrangement eradicates monetary hindrances, ensuring that you can pursue the compensation you deserve without burdensome economic pressure in difficult times.

Settlement Negotiations vs. Trial
Not every injury claim goes to trial. Most are resolved through settlement discussions where the lawyer plays a pivotal role in securing a fair offer from insurers or adversaries. Negotiated settlements offer several merits, including:
- Speedier settlement process.
- Skipping extended court proceedings.
- Minimized financial and emotional burdens.
However, if negotiations are unsuccessful, the case may move forward to trial. In such instances, your attorney will be ready to make a persuasive case before a judge or jury. This dual approach ensures your case is defended whether your case is settled out of court or proceeded in court.
